Output 73ec71958af5ca1f6222a106238b676b6a399b839fd452eb1a7fcaedb372d9fc:0

value
204738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7afa46230b66f20750079a0a43fc1d0c15aa0208 OP_EQUAL
address
3CuGBHdSdhJBaPLMVpGuMe5s1xAjghz18U
transaction
73ec71958af5ca1f6222a106238b676b6a399b839fd452eb1a7fcaedb372d9fc
confirmations
329449
spent
false

1 Sat Range